Bayelsa State Deputy Governor, Lawrence Ewhrudjakpo, was rushed to the Federal Medical Centre (FMC) in Yenagoa on Thursday after he reportedly collapsed in his office.
Security personnel immediately cordoned off the medical facility, while senior government officials visited to assess the situation and express concern.
Efforts to obtain comments from the deputy governor’s media aide, Doubara Atasi, were unsuccessful as of press time.
A member of FMC’s management, who spoke anonymously, confirmed that Ewhrudjakpo is receiving “the best possible care” and is in stable condition.
The Bayelsa State Government has yet to issue an official statement on the incident.
